Nov 15, 2025 analytical
“Yeah, jump a guillotine. Try to keep the fight in the middle of the octagon. Keep your back off the fence... looking back [when I fought him] I worried so much about his wrestling, I couldn't get off my combination, my footing. I was worried about the shots. I didn't do what I do well. He just has to stay out of his own way and fight his fight”

– jokingly advices to Jack Della Maddalena via UFC 322 Q&A.

Nov 11, 2025 analytical
“I think both guys are great at certain things. It’s all going to come down to the takedown defense of 'JDM.' If he can get back up to his feet, if he can use the fence, or stay off the fence, use his boxing, I think he definitely could give Islam a lot of trouble in the center of the octagon. He’s a great striker. He’s big and powerful.”

– Shares his thoughts on UFC 322 main event via MMA Fighting.
Nov 11, 2025 analytical
“Islam is not a small man... He’s a guy who’s been holding his body back from naturally being bigger like he wants to be, so he can compete in the lightweight division... He’s going to look like a solid welterweight in a title fight. But it’s going to come down to his ability to get takedowns and hold JDM down. If JDM can get back up over and over and scramble, I think he’s going to give Islam a lot of problems with the exchanges of boxing”

– Shares his thoughts on UFC 322 main event via MMA Fighting.
